Use security data sheets (SDSs) to learn more about the chemical residential or commercial properties, carcinogen, and needed personal protective devices (PPE) that you will need.


Find out more concerning handwashing and the threat of infections. Modification out of work clothes prior to leaving the work site. If any kind of sewer has actually gotten onto your garments, transform them today. Stained job garments must be sealed in a plastic bag and washed individually from various other clothes. Clean your hands thoroughly after handling the apparel.

Some states certify journeymen and master plumbing professionals individually, while others certify just master plumbings. To come to be certified, plumbings need to fulfill standards for training and experience, and in many situations, pass an accreditation test.


The Red Seal Program, formally called the Interprovincial Specification Red Seal Program, is a program that establishes usual criteria to assess the skills of tradespeople across Canada. The Red Seal, when affixed to a provincial or territorial trade certificate, indicates that a tradesperson has shown the knowledge required for the national standard because profession.


As part of this program, direction in the fundamentals of this contact form gas fitting will be undertaken. Upon completion, these essentials in gas installation will allow the plumbing technician to not just obtain their plumbing certificate yet additionally an acting gas permit, and bring out gas job under the guidance of a completely certified gas fitter.

There are several sorts of dangers to a plumbing. These include electrical shock, stress and strains, cuts and lacerations, bruises and contusions, fractures, burns and scalds, foreign bodies in the eye, and ruptures. Operating at elevation or in confined spaces, or functioning with lead and asbestos are all on-site dangers that plumbings can encounter.
